Gloria Attoun

Go

2017-08-10

I thought this one was fairly average overall. Her voice sounds pretty similar to a Joni Mitchell, but a little more bluegrass feel to it, and the music. There are a few songs which sound similar to one another which kind of pushed me away, but it was still solid. There is some good picking going on however, which shows there is some musicianship involved, but just needs to be refined a little bit in my opinion. Decent. Tracks 3, 4, 10, and 12 were my favorites.

review by Matt
